SCOTTISH HOTELS OUTPERFORM THE REST OF THE UK

Scotland’s hotels are outperforming the rest of the UK, according to PKF’s latest monthly snapshot of hotel occupancy levels. In May, occupancy levels rose by 0.6% to 77% compared with the same time last year with England reporting 73.3% occupancy rates and Wales 74.9%.Yield per room also increased by 3.1% to £55.83 in Scotland. CASTLE LEISURE GROUP GO UNDER

Castle Leisure Group (CLG), the Stirling-based pub group owned by brothers Paul and Stephen Smith, has gone under. The group which was established in 1981 operates venues in Edinburgh, Falkirk, Stirling, Dumbarton and Dunfermline. £1BN OF SALES FOR GREENE KING

Greene King sales have topped a £1bn for the first time in the company’s 212 year history. The company’s latest annual results reveal that total revenues rose 6%, driven by a rising demand for pub meals. This led to a 14% rise in pre-tax profits to £140m.
